Đề Câu 1 :
[You must be registered and logged in to see this link.]//Cau 1: Thiet ke lop CHangHoa,co cac thuoc tinh la mahang,tenhang,soluong,giaban
//Xay dung cac phuong thuc : xuat , nhap , ham tao , ham huy , tinh tong tien(tong tien = so luong*giaban)
//Giai:
#include<conio.h>
#include<iostream.h>
#include<string.h>
class CHangHoa
{
private:
int mahang;
char tenhang[10];
int soluong;
int giaban;
public:
void nhap();
void xuat();
CHangHoa(){}
CHangHoa(int ma,char *ten,int so,int gia)
{
mahang=ma;
strcpy(tenhang,ten);
soluong=so;
giaban=gia;
}
void tongtien();
};
void CHangHoa::nhap()
{
cout<<"Nhap ma hang: ";cin>>mahang;
cout<<"Nhap ten hang: ";cin>>tenhang;
cout<<"Nhap so luong: ";cin>>soluong;
cout<<"Nhap gia ban: ";cin>>giaban;
}
void CHangHoa::xuat()
{
cout<<"Ma hang : "<<mahang;
cout<<"Ten hang : "<<tenhang;
cout<<"So luong: "<<soluong;
cout<<"Gia ban: "<<giaban;
}
void CHangHoa::tongtien()
{
int t;
t=soluong*giaban;
cout<<"Tong tien la: "<<t;
}
void main()
{
clrscr();
CHangHoa a;
a.nhap();
a.xuat();
a.tongtien();
getch();
}